Yes... WILL install over the old one. You will not lose the 
favorites.

But, you can easily backup the favorites by going to BOOKMARKS > 
MANAG BOOKMARKS. Then go to FILE > EXPORT and save it somewhere. 
You can later, if necessary, IMPORT the same way.
